When Han Ruochen returned home, she knew that there was something weird going on. Even though the air was thick with the scent of coal smoke and drying shrimps, Han Ruochen couldn’t help but frown. She wasn’t heading to the docks yet because the modifications would take some time, and Old Man Wu, even with all his efforts, could deliver the fishing boat by the day after tomorrow at best.

However, even though the boat wouldn’t be delivered right away, Han Ruochen still wanted to go to the shore with her traps, which was why she returned home to grab a change of clothes before going to her grandmother’s.

"Are you going back home?" Han Ruochen asked her brother, who returned to the village with her. She thought that the man would go back home once she was done with her work, but surprisingly, he came with her to the fishing village.

Han Yong had his hands shoved in his pockets and was walking straight toward the Han family’s house. He said to her, "I want to make dinner for us; it has been a while since I cooked." Han Yong knew that if he returned home, Madam Xu would certainly hide all the food and spices. She had clearly told him that he needed to bring the washing machine home, as her brother’s laundry was getting out of control. There was also their son, who was used to ruining three sets of clothing in a day.

But for some reason, Han Yong had never been able to accept this son of his as his own. Even though Madam Xu had insisted that the child was his own, Han Yong just couldn’t accept that Han Zhicheng was his son because, even after turning nine, he still couldn’t find any resemblance between Han Zhicheng and him. The more Han Zhicheng grew up, the more Han Yong thought that the boy did not resemble him. His eyes were too small, and his lips were too thin.

Both he and Madam Xu had big eyes and full lips. But only their son was different, so how could Han Yong not be suspicious?

Thus, his desire to snatch the washing machine from his sister was close to none. Why would he care whether or not the clothes of Han Zhicheng and his brother-in-law were washed in time or not? If Madam Xu was worried, then she might as well wash those clothes on her own. Anyway, he was not going to ask for the washing machine.

The only downside was that he would find the refrigerator closed if he returned without the washing machine. Since that was the case, he might as well eat his dinner at home.

Han Ruochen took a deep look at her brother but did not say anything. She knew Madam Xu’s temper; since she couldn’t get the washing machine, she had thrown down the threat that she would not let Han Zhicheng visit, but she forgot one thing.

Unlike her mother, who had the time of her life, her father was the only one earning bread and butter for the family. Thus, he never had any time to spend with Han Zhicheng. What was more, Han Zhicheng’s temper and personality were particularly nasty. Her father still had some patience when Han Zhicheng was young, but ever since he grew up, her father did not have the patience or energy to deal with him anymore.

She spent her time at school and on household chores, so she did not spend any time with Han Zhicheng either. And the boy did not like her either.

Han Jianyou disliked Han Zhicheng even more and would rather play outside than return home whenever that brat came to visit, and as Han Beijiang was often bullied by Han Zhicheng, he did not like him either. So in the Han family, other than her mother and Han Ziyan, no one cared whether Han Zhicheng came to visit or not.

Since her threat was particularly useless, Xu Yuanshu had no other choice but to send her brother. But her brother would rather chuck the washing machine into the sea than give it to Xu Yuanshu and her family. Maybe Xu Yuanshu was under the impression that she had subdued her brother? Haha, no one had ever been able to subdue Han Yong. Not even their father. Who did she think she was?

Han Ruochen was in a good mood because she thought that her big brother could still change, but her good mood was ruined the second she pushed open the door. Because the second she stepped through the gates of the courtyard, someone rushed toward her.

"Demon! Thief of luck! Return what you stole from my Ziyan."

Before Han Ruochen could even react, the shadow that was hiding in the porch rushed toward her and swung the heavy wooden bucket through the air. A second later, the thick, metallic crimson liquid exploded all over her.

It was not water but cold, viscous blood of a dog.

Han Ruochen stood there dumbly. She could not understand what was going on as the red filth dripped from her hair and soaked her clothes. She knew that dog blood could be used to deal with bad spirits but —

Why would her mom dump this on her head?

"Mom, what are you doing!?" Han Yong was stunned as well. He rushed to wipe the gore from her eyes; before he could do it, Han Ruochen had wiped the blood off her eyes and looked at her mother. She coldly asked, "What is the meaning of this?" She was no longer willing to call her mother as mom. It was one thing that her mother had been biased toward Han Ziyan, but just because she was doing better than her sister, her mother actually gave the credit to an evil spirit and even took the liberty to attack her like that.

"I am saving this house and family!" shouted Meng Yunhan. Her face was twisted with a hint of fear and apprehension as she said, "Old Witch Zhu said that you have been possessed by a water ghoul, and you were the one who sold your soul to suck the luck out of this family. You wretched girl, I never knew that you were this vicious. You actually stole your sister’s luck."
